A hot melt adhesive, also known as a hot glue, is the name given to a polymer-based mostly glue which is solid at room temperature and is utilized in a molten state.

 

 

 

 

There are three primary stages to the process of a hot melt adhesive bonding collectively materials. Firstly, the strong adhesive is heated till it reaches its softening level, at which stage it will turn to liquid. The molten adhesive is then utilized and wets the substrate. The period available to make the bond between making use of the thermoplastic adhesive and bringing in the secondary materials is called the open time. Lastly, cooling time will then occur. This typically varies from just a couple of seconds to up to 5 minutes, and during which the hot melt will solidify and very quickly build up power and stability. This fast turn around permits for a quick processing time and speedy assembly.

 

 

 

 

 

 

 

 

Major Components of Hot Melt Adhesives:

 

 

Polymers: These help to offer the adhesive power and flexibility, as well as heat and impact resistance.

 

 

 

 

Resins: Control the wetting of the adhesive (how long it remains a liquid whilst involved with the substrate).

 

 

 

 

Wax: Primarily controls the open time, and the way long the bond takes to form. It also helps thin the adhesive for application. The higher the wax content present within a hot melt, the higher viscosity and better flexibility the bond will have. High levels of wax also enable for a quicker bond.

 

 

 

 

Antioxidants: These are used primarily to assist protect the material during its shelf life.

 

 

 

 

Advantages of Hot Melt Adhesives:

 

 

Good for hard to reach areas: As the adhesive is utilized in a purely liquid form, it allows for easy application to more obscure places or surfaces which other glue or adhesive products can't do as well. Many glue weapons and nozzles are manufactured to distribute the glue into these small complicated places ensuring all the chosen surface is reachable and covered which in turn, permits for stronger bonds.

 

 

 

 

Speed and ease: As the whole process of using hot melt adhesives is quick, this lowers assembly time and allows for optimum productivity with a fast turnaround.

 

 

 

 

Bonds number of substrates: Hot melt adhesives are specifically formulated for specific tasks. A wide number of supplies can be bonded, such as wood or corrugated cardboard. Heat sensitive supplies akin to foam and even some plastics and metal may also be bonded utilizing hot melt adhesive when dispensed at a lower temperature. They can additionally bond both porous and non-porous surfaces.

 

 

 

 

Neat Application: The bond which forms from a hot melt adhesive is practically invisible which offers an overall pleasing aesthetic. This is particularly useful when used for items reminiscent of signs, displays or even furniture.

 

 

 

 

Lengthy shelf life: Hot melt adhesives have wonderful moisture resistance and do not want refrigeration meaning they remain firmly bonded for an intensive period.

 

 

 

 

Challenges of hot melt adhesives:

 

 

As with most adhesive products, alongside the benefits, hot melt adhesives have a few limitations. The temperature at which hot melt adhesives are set at is crucial to the application process.

 

 

 

 

As soon as molten, the adhesive have to be hot sufficient for assembly. If the adhesive just isn't hot sufficient at this stage, a weak bond could also be formed which can be known as a cold bond.

 

 

Nevertheless, if the hot melt adhesive is utilized in a molten state at too high a temperature, it will stay in a liquid state for too long and result in a soft bond being formed. Any stress or weight on this bond will cause a weakening which could fail immediately.

 

 

Unlike other adhesives, if hot melts bonds are re-heated to their softening point temperature, the earlier adhesion caused by the cooling process can be reversed. Though this does make hot melt adhesives more versatile and simpler to repeatedly change, it can cause a hindrance ought to this be applied to a substrate which will undergo or survive in an environment with higher temperatures. Nonetheless, many hot melts are now being manufactured with higher levels of heat resistance to combat this.
